Stewardship
The responsible management and care of resources or property, often with a focus on conservation and sustainability.
Planetary Management
The active manipulation and management of a planet's environment and resources to ensure sustainability and habitability for its inhabitants.
Inherent Value
The intrinsic worth of something, independent of its utility or application.
Instrumental Value
Refers to the value that something has as a means to a desired or valued end, not valuable in itself but for what it leads to.
